Los Angeles Dodgers Salaries - 2009
| Player | Salary (US$) |
| 1. Manny Ramirez | 23,854,494 |
| 2. Jim Thome | 13,000,000 |
| 3. Hiroki Kuroda | 12,433,333 |
| 4. Vicente Padilla | 12,000,000 |
| 5. Juan Pierre | 10,000,000 |
| 6. Rafael Furcal | 7,500,000 |
| 7. Jon Garland | 6,250,000 |
| 8. Casey Blake | 5,000,000 |
| 9. Randy Wolf | 4,956,237 |
| 10. Russell Martin | 3,900,000 |
| 11. Orlando Hudson | 3,364,877 |
| 12. Andre Ethier | 3,100,000 |
| 13. Guillermo Mota | 2,350,000 |
| 14. Ronnie Belliard | 1,900,000 |
| 15. Jonathan Broxton | 1,825,000 |
| 16. Mark Loretta | 1,250,000 |
| 17. Brad Ausmus | 1,000,000 |
| 18. Chad Billingsley | 475,000 |
| 19. Matt Kemp | 467,000 |
| 20. James Loney | 465,000 |
| 21. Hong-Chih Kuo | 437,000 |
| 22. Blake DeWitt | 405,000 |
| 23. Clayton Kershaw | 404,000 |
| 24. Ramon Troncoso | 401,000 |
| 25. James McDonald | 400,750 |
| Total Team Salary: | 100,008,592 |
